工作原理:安装箱1的一侧连接有外部电源、第一开关和第二开关,外部电源、第一开关和第一电机4通过导线依次连接构成回路,外部电源、第二开关和第二电机21通过导线依次连接构成回路,首先通过第二开关控制第二电机21转动,第二电机21转动并带动带动第二皮带轮22转动,第二皮带轮22通过皮带带动第一皮带轮20转动,第一皮带轮20带动转轴18在第二转动槽17内转动,转轴18再通过两个第二锥形齿轮19带动对应的第一锥形齿轮16转动,第一锥形齿轮16通过转动柱15带动蜗杆13在第一转动槽12内转动,两个蜗杆13在通过对应的蜗轮11带动两个螺杆7转动,两个螺杆7相互靠近并带动两个夹板9在支撑板10上滑动并相互靠近,从而夹紧放置在支撑板10上的沉香木枕,这时再通过第一开关启动第一电机4,第一电机4再带动打磨盘5转动并对沉香木枕进行打磨。Working principle: One side of the installation box 1 is connected with an external power supply, a first switch and a second switch. The external power supply, the first switch and the first motor 4 are connected in sequence through wires to form a loop. The external power supply, the second switch and the second motor 21 are connected in turn by wires to form a loop. First, the second motor 21 is controlled by the second switch to rotate. The second motor 21 rotates and drives the second pulley 22 to rotate. The second pulley 22 drives the first pulley 20 through the belt to rotate. The first pulley 20 drives the rotating shaft 18 to rotate in the second rotating groove 17, the rotating shaft 18 drives the corresponding first bevel gear 16 to rotate through the two second bevel gears 19, and the first bevel gear 16 drives the worm 13 to rotate through the rotating column 15. The first rotation groove 12 rotates, and the two worms 13 drive the two screws 7 to rotate through the corresponding worm gears 11. The two screws 7 approach each other and drive the two clamping plates 9 to slide on the support plate 10 and approach each other, thereby clamping For the agarwood sleeper placed on the support plate 10, the first motor 4 is activated through the first switch, and the first motor 4 drives the grinding disc 5 to rotate and grind the agarwood sleeper.
